These workshops will benefit researchers in the Global South by addressing the following specific needs:

a) Updated knowledge of recent developments and advanced research in relevant subject areas

b) Guidance on academic writing in general

c) Constructive feedback on a specific piece of writing

d) General guidance on publishing

e) Specific advice on the suitable publication forum for a specific piece

f) Establishing contacts with editors of relevant journals

g) Skills development regarding external funding applications

h) Developing the confidence that despite tremendous resource constraints, researchers in the Global South can produce world-class scholarship (addressed by a panel consisting of leading local scholars with a strong publication track record)

i) Developing a local and regional network of early career researchers

j) Career progression (by ensuring skills development, providing enhanced publication opportunities, and facilitating local and global networking as part of the workshop).
